Pros

Recognition and Growth Opportunities – Mattress Firm values its employees and recognizes top performers. I've won multiple awards, including Manager of the Year and induction into the Circle of Excellence, which shows the company rewards hard work and dedication. Performance-Based Incentives – The company offers strong incentives for sales and service, allowing high performers to earn well beyond their base pay through commissions and bonuses. Career Development – There are opportunities for advancement within the company. Training and Support – Mattress Firm provides solid training in sales techniques, customer service, and product knowledge, which can help employees build valuable skills in retail, sales, and management. Team Environment – The culture promotes teamwork and camaraderie, making it an enjoyable place to work for those who thrive in a sales-driven setting. Autonomy in Sales – Employees often have the freedom to run their store like their own business, allowing them to manage sales strategies, customer interactions, and daily operations. Customer Interaction – If you enjoy helping people, this job provides plenty of face-to-face interaction, assisting customers in finding the right sleep solutions. Flexible Scheduling (to an extent) – While retail schedules can be demanding, there is some flexibility for employees to manage their time effectively.

Cons

There is an abundance of information and it can sometimes be overwhelming. I've been in this industry for 19 years and I can say that Mattress Firm has very few "cons" that are hardly noticeable.

Pros

Lots of autonomy in role, opportunities to bonus. Great discounts on sleep products and the sales teams are well compensated, as compared to competitors or similar industries.

Cons

Lack of clarity around goals and metrics, it is unclear what you need to do to "win" as performance reviews are based on 15+ KPIs and they are not aligned to what drives your bonus. As an external DM, there is a huge gap in onboarding and support from RVP and no real training. Although engagement and retention are important, the company has made very minimal changes to support work/life balance for the sales team who have limited flexibility around sales holidays and required hours. All responsibilities and corporate changes happening at the field level are left to the DM to implement with unclear or unreasonable expectations.
